Payroll Administrator

1 week ago


Burlington, Canada D & A Group Inc Full time

Responsibilities
- Calculate and process HR and payroll systems (ADP, Sage50) for clients
- Maintain ROE requests
- Liaison with ADP, government agencies, clients
- Provide professional payroll customer service to clients
- Ensure compliance with Federal and Provincial payroll legislation

**Qualifications**:

- 1-2 Years payroll Experience
- Highly Organized and Detail Oriented
- Understanding Canadian Payroll legislation and ESA.
- Excelling Communication Skills
- Team Oriented

**Job Types**: Full-time, Part-time

**Salary**: $18.00-$24.00 per hour

Schedule:

- 8 hour shift
- Monday to Friday

**Experience**:

- payroll: 1 year (required)

Work Location: In person
